Acerca de este título
The story of Watergate is usually told through the prism of straight white male journalists and politicians who were at the center of the scandal—but Watergate happened to all of us—wives, mothers, children, Black, White, queer, immigrants. Those voices and perceptions are rarely heard today. Everything You Always Wanted to Know About Watergate was envisioned as a book that looks at the wider ripples of the Watergate explosion and how it changed the way Americans saw themselves, their country, and the world around them. This is both a serious and irreverent book, put together by a team of two newspaper journalists and 10 college interns from throughout the country. Think of it as a primer on Watergate for the generation that grew up watching The Daily Show.
